What Is a Sexual Health Clinic?

A Sexual Health Clinic in Kitchener is a specialized healthcare facility focused on diagnosing, preventing, and managing sexual and reproductive health concerns in a confidential and respectful setting.

Why It Matters

Sexual health is a key part of overall wellness. When left unaddressed, concerns can affect:

  • Physical health
  • Mental well-being
  • Relationships
  • Long-term quality of life

Simple Explanation

Sexual health clinics provide education, screenings, consultations, and medical guidance in a private environment. Clinics like Urogened Cambridge focus on patient comfort, trust, and medically accurate information.

How Sexual Health Clinics Support Preventive Care

Preventive care is one of the most valuable aspects of sexual health clinics.

 

Step-by-Step Patient Experience

1.     Private consultation: Discuss concerns in a confidential setting

2.     Professional assessment: Based on current medical guidelines

3.     Education & guidance: Understanding your health clearly

4.     Personalized plan: Tailored recommendations for wellness

5.     Ongoing support: Follow-up care when needed

Expert Tips for Maintaining Sexual Wellness

Maintaining sexual health is an ongoing process. Here are expert-approved tips:

  • Schedule regular checkups at a trusted sexual health clinic
  • Don’t ignore symptoms, even if they seem minor
  • Seek reliable information from medical professionals
  • Communicate openly with healthcare providers
  • Prioritize preventive care, not just treatment
